Modern Leopard Dress


I bought this fabric a couple of years ago from Laura's Fashion Fabric in
White Rock, BC & I love it!  I was thinking of a simply boatneck
shift dress but chose this very easy McCall's 6199 pattern.


It is that type of pattern that you can make a dress
in the afternoon to wear to dinner.....which I did.


I made the long sleeve version & added some Tiffany
Blue bias type for the neckline & cuffs.
I like the contrast!

1 pattern...3 dresses


I have been going through my fabric collection & trying to use some of it up before I buy more.  I have had this pink plaid fabric for a couple of years now & have made 4 dresses with it already!  I still have enough leftover for a maxi skirt.


I used this easy McCall's pattern 6199.  I altered the pattern for the pink plaid dress by taking in the sides about 2 inches so there was no need for a belt.


The long sleeve version with black lace added to neckline & sleeves.


My bold print flower dress from the summer.  If you want a real easy dress to make this is the pattern!
